Yun Gao created FLINK-26402: ------------------------------- Summary: MinioTestContainerTest.testS3EndpointNeedsToBeSpecifiedBeforeInitializingFileSyste failed due to Container startup failed Key: FLINK-26402 URL: https://issues.apache.org/jira/browse/FLINK-26402 Project: Flink Issue Type: Bug Components: FileSystems Affects Versions: 1.15.0 Reporter: Yun Gao
{code:java} 2022-02-24T02:49:59.3646340Z Feb 24 02:49:59 [ERROR] Tests run: 6,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 49.457 s <<< FAILURE! - in org.apache.flink.fs.s3.common.MinioTestContainerTest 2022-02-24T02:49:59.3648027Z Feb 24 02:49:59 [ERROR] org.apache.flink.fs.s3.common.MinioTestContainerTest.testS3EndpointNeedsToBeSpecifiedBeforeInitializingFileSyste Time elapsed: 5.751 s <<< ERROR! 2022-02-24T02:49:59.3648805Z Feb 24 02:49:59 org.testcontainers.containers.ContainerLaunchException: Container startup failed 2022-02-24T02:49:59.3651640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.doStart(GenericContainer.java:336) 2022-02-24T02:49:59.3652820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.start(GenericContainer.java:317) 2022-02-24T02:49:59.3653619Z Feb 24 02:49:59 at org.apache.flink.core.testutils.TestContainerExtension.instantiateTestContainer(TestContainerExtension.java:59) 2022-02-24T02:49:59.3654319Z Feb 24 02:49:59 at org.apache.flink.core.testutils.TestContainerExtension.before(TestContainerExtension.java:70) 2022-02-24T02:49:59.3655057Z Feb 24 02:49:59 at org.apache.flink.core.testutils.EachCallbackWrapper.beforeEach(EachCallbackWrapper.java:45) 2022-02-24T02:49:59.3656153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.lambda$invokeBeforeEachCallbacks$2(TestMethodTestDescriptor.java:163) 2022-02-24T02:49:59.3657088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.lambda$invokeBeforeMethodsOrCallbacksUntilExceptionOccurs$6(TestMethodTestDescriptor.java:199) 2022-02-24T02:49:59.3657905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3659016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.invokeBeforeMethodsOrCallbacksUntilExceptionOccurs(TestMethodTestDescriptor.java:199) 2022-02-24T02:49:59.3660004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.invokeBeforeEachCallbacks(TestMethodTestDescriptor.java:162) 2022-02-24T02:49:59.3660997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:129) 2022-02-24T02:49:59.3662153Z Feb 24 02:49:59 at org.junit.jupiter.engine.descriptor.TestMethodTestDescriptor.execute(TestMethodTestDescriptor.java:66) 2022-02-24T02:49:59.3663189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:151) 2022-02-24T02:49:59.3664211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3664971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141) 2022-02-24T02:49:59.3665623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137) 2022-02-24T02:49:59.3666433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139) 2022-02-24T02:49:59.3667322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3668024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138) 2022-02-24T02:49:59.3669276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95) 2022-02-24T02:49:59.3669881Z Feb 24 02:49:59 at java.util.ArrayList.forEach(ArrayList.java:1259) 2022-02-24T02:49:59.3670715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.invokeAll(SameThreadHierarchicalTestExecutorService.java:41) 2022-02-24T02:49:59.3671652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:155) 2022-02-24T02:49:59.3672725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3673436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141) 2022-02-24T02:49:59.3682533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137) 2022-02-24T02:49:59.3683383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139) 2022-02-24T02:49:59.3684081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3684890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138) 2022-02-24T02:49:59.3685547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95) 2022-02-24T02:49:59.3686250Z Feb 24 02:49:59 at java.util.ArrayList.forEach(ArrayList.java:1259) 2022-02-24T02:49:59.3686918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.invokeAll(SameThreadHierarchicalTestExecutorService.java:41) 2022-02-24T02:49:59.3688009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:155) 2022-02-24T02:49:59.3688987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3689805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141) 2022-02-24T02:49:59.3690447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137) 2022-02-24T02:49:59.3691203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139) 2022-02-24T02:49:59.3692232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73) 2022-02-24T02:49:59.3692927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138) 2022-02-24T02:49:59.3693712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95) 2022-02-24T02:49:59.3694482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.SameThreadHierarchicalTestExecutorService.submit(SameThreadHierarchicalTestExecutorService.java:35) 2022-02-24T02:49:59.3695394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.HierarchicalTestExecutor.execute(HierarchicalTestExecutor.java:57) 2022-02-24T02:49:59.3696109Z Feb 24 02:49:59 at org.junit.platform.engine.support.hierarchical.HierarchicalTestEngine.execute(HierarchicalTestEngine.java:54) 2022-02-24T02:49:59.3696929Z Feb 24 02:49:59 at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:107) 2022-02-24T02:49:59.3697733Z Feb 24 02:49:59 at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:88) 2022-02-24T02:49:59.3698609Z Feb 24 02:49:59 at org.junit.platform.launcher.core.EngineExecutionOrchestrator.lambda$execute$0(EngineExecutionOrchestrator.java:54) 2022-02-24T02:49:59.3699505Z Feb 24 02:49:59 at org.junit.platform.launcher.core.EngineExecutionOrchestrator.withInterceptedStreams(EngineExecutionOrchestrator.java:67) 2022-02-24T02:49:59.3700228Z Feb 24 02:49:59 at org.junit.platform.launcher.core.EngineExecutionOrchestrator.execute(EngineExecutionOrchestrator.java:52) 2022-02-24T02:49:59.3700877Z Feb 24 02:49:59 at org.junit.platform.launcher.core.DefaultLauncher.execute(DefaultLauncher.java:114) 2022-02-24T02:49:59.3701555Z Feb 24 02:49:59 at org.junit.platform.launcher.core.DefaultLauncher.execute(DefaultLauncher.java:86) 2022-02-24T02:49:59.3702574Z Feb 24 02:49:59 at org.junit.platform.launcher.core.DefaultLauncherSession$DelegatingLauncher.execute(DefaultLauncherSession.java:86) 2022-02-24T02:49:59.3703489Z Feb 24 02:49:59 at org.junit.platform.launcher.core.SessionPerRequestLauncher.execute(SessionPerRequestLauncher.java:53) 2022-02-24T02:49:59.3704552Z Feb 24 02:49:59 at org.apache.maven.surefire.junitplatform.JUnitPlatformProvider.lambda$execute$1(JUnitPlatformProvider.java:199) 2022-02-24T02:49:59.3705187Z Feb 24 02:49:59 at java.util.Iterator.forEachRemaining(Iterator.java:116) 2022-02-24T02:49:59.3705816Z Feb 24 02:49:59 at org.apache.maven.surefire.junitplatform.JUnitPlatformProvider.execute(JUnitPlatformProvider.java:193) 2022-02-24T02:49:59.3706777Z Feb 24 02:49:59 at org.apache.maven.surefire.junitplatform.JUnitPlatformProvider.invokeAllTests(JUnitPlatformProvider.java:154) 2022-02-24T02:49:59.3707569Z Feb 24 02:49:59 at org.apache.maven.surefire.junitplatform.JUnitPlatformProvider.invoke(JUnitPlatformProvider.java:120) 2022-02-24T02:49:59.3708546Z Feb 24 02:49:59 at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:428) 2022-02-24T02:49:59.3709487Z Feb 24 02:49:59 at org.apache.maven.surefire.booter.ForkedBooter.execute(ForkedBooter.java:162) 2022-02-24T02:49:59.3710303Z Feb 24 02:49:59 at org.apache.maven.surefire.booter.ForkedBooter.run(ForkedBooter.java:562) 2022-02-24T02:49:59.3710880Z Feb 24 02:49:59 at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:548) 2022-02-24T02:49:59.3711639Z Feb 24 02:49:59 Caused by: org.rnorth.ducttape.RetryCountExceededException: Retry limit hit with exception 2022-02-24T02:49:59.3712526Z Feb 24 02:49:59 at org.rnorth.ducttape.unreliables.Unreliables.retryUntilSuccess(Unreliables.java:88) 2022-02-24T02:49:59.3713396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.doStart(GenericContainer.java:329) 2022-02-24T02:49:59.3713895Z Feb 24 02:49:59 ... 60 more 2022-02-24T02:49:59.3714527Z Feb 24 02:49:59 Caused by: org.testcontainers.containers.ContainerLaunchException: Could not create/start container 2022-02-24T02:49:59.3715344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.tryStart(GenericContainer.java:525) 2022-02-24T02:49:59.3715974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.lambda$doStart$0(GenericContainer.java:331) 2022-02-24T02:49:59.3716747Z Feb 24 02:49:59 at org.rnorth.ducttape.unreliables.Unreliables.retryUntilSuccess(Unreliables.java:81) 2022-02-24T02:49:59.3717424Z Feb 24 02:49:59 ... 61 more 2022-02-24T02:49:59.3718767Z Feb 24 02:49:59 Caused by: com.amazonaws.services.s3.model.AmazonS3Exception: Server not initialized, please try again. (Service: Amazon S3; Status Code: 503; Error Code: XMinioServerNotInitialized; Request ID: 16D699089DE1A760; S3 Extended Request ID: 16D699089DE1A760; Proxy: null), S3 Extended Request ID: 16D699089DE1A760 2022-02-24T02:49:59.3720373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.handleErrorResponse(AmazonHttpClient.java:1819) 2022-02-24T02:49:59.3721601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.handleServiceErrorResponse(AmazonHttpClient.java:1403) 2022-02-24T02:49:59.3722805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eOneRequest(AmazonHttpClient.java:1372) 2022-02-24T02:49:59.3723757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eHelper(AmazonHttpClient.java:1145) 2022-02-24T02:49:59.3724980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.doExecute(AmazonHttpClient.java:802) 2022-02-24T02:49:59.3725967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.executeWithTimer(AmazonHttpClient.java:770) 2022-02-24T02:49:59.3726874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.execute(AmazonHttpClient.java:744) 2022-02-24T02:49:59.3727827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utor.access$500(AmazonHttpClient.java:704) 2022-02-24T02:49:59.3728861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ient$RequestExecutionBuilderImpl.execute(AmazonHttpClient.java:686) 2022-02-24T02:49:59.3729846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ient.execute(AmazonHttpClient.java:550) 2022-02-24T02:49:59.3730950Z Feb 24 02:49:59 at com.amazonaws.http.AmazonHttpClient.execute(AmazonHttpClient.java:530) 2022-02-24T02:49:59.3732135Z Feb 24 02:49:59 at com.amazonaws.services.s3.AmazonS3Client.invoke(AmazonS3Client.java:5259) 2022-02-24T02:49:59.3733030Z Feb 24 02:49:59 at com.amazonaws.services.s3.AmazonS3Client.invoke(AmazonS3Client.java:5206) 2022-02-24T02:49:59.3733909Z Feb 24 02:49:59 at com.amazonaws.services.s3.AmazonS3Client.createBucket(AmazonS3Client.java:1119) 2022-02-24T02:49:59.3734654Z Feb 24 02:49:59 at com.amazonaws.services.s3.AmazonS3Client.createBucket(AmazonS3Client.java:1051) 2022-02-24T02:49:59.3735270Z Feb 24 02:49:59 at org.apache.flink.fs.s3.common.MinioTestContainer.createDefaultBucket(MinioTestContainer.java:128) 2022-02-24T02:49:59.3735940Z Feb 24 02:49:59 at org.apache.flink.fs.s3.common.MinioTestContainer.containerIsStarted(MinioTestContainer.java:83) 2022-02-24T02:49:59.3736598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.containerIsStarted(GenericContainer.java:688) 2022-02-24T02:49:59.3737237Z Feb 24 02:49:59 at org.testcontainers.containers.GenericContainer.tryStart(GenericContainer.java:504) 2022-02-24T02:49:59.3737711Z Feb 24 02:49:59 ... 63 more {code} -- This message was sent by Atlassian Jira (v8.20.1#820001)